RSS Leader Urges Calm Amid Global Energy Concerns

Speaking at an Eid Milan ceremony in Delhi, Indresh Kumar, a leader of the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h (RSS), emphasized the need to avoid creating panic regarding oil and gas supply, reassuring that India has ample resources. Discussions at the event also covered topics like the West Asia conflict, global oil worries, and India’s energy security measures.

Kumar highlighted India’s self-assurance amidst global tensions, citing the government’s assurance of meeting the nation’s energy requirements. Experts at the meeting acknowledged India’s enhanced energy strategies, including diversified import sources and a focus on alternative energy, ensuring self-sufficiency and effective crisis management.

Addressing electoral integrity, Kumar stressed the importance of transparent and secure democratic processes. He underlined the necessity to prevent electoral irregularities and infiltration, warning of potential threats to national unity and security. Other speakers echoed the significance of fair elections, emphasizing societal participation and countering misinformation.
